Overview
Foetality: Fetus Deletus plunges players into a darkly comedic and utterly bizarre local multiplayer experience. Set within the confines of a mother's womb, players embody Hannibal Lecker, a character with an insatiable appetite for his unborn siblings. The core gameplay revolves around a unique form of combat where players wiggle and grab at opponents, literally nibbling away at their limbs until they are completely consumed. It's a chaotic free-for-all where only the hungriest Hannibal Lecker can emerge victorious.

Game Info
Developed and published by DieEltern, Foetality: Fetus Deletus is a 2D arcade action title that emphasizes player-versus-player combat. It features a training mode for honing your cannibalistic skills and supports single-player and shared/split-screen modes. The game boasts hand-drawn visuals and whacky physics, contributing to its distinctive dark comedy and dark humor appeal. It was released on February 20, 2025, and is available in English and German.
